Fundamental to our Think and Act Globally strategy and digital adoption, Enterprise Capabilities (EC) is AECOM’s primary vehicle for workshare. Operating across geographic boundaries and time-zones, EC partners with regional and Global Business Line project teams to provide technical expertise, accelerate delivery and keep AECOM competitive in the industry. 

With a team of over 3000 technical professionals located across nine countries and remote technical anchors, EC teams are trusted to deliver high-quality, specialist services that help to fill capability gaps, resourcing needs and technical constraints on projects of all scopes and sizes.

What you need to know about the Chennai Tech Scene

To locals, it's no secret that South India is leading the charge in big data infrastructure. While the environmental impact of data centers has long been a concern, emerging hubs like Chennai are favored by companies seeking ready access to renewable energy resources, which provide more sustainable and cost-effective solutions. As a result, Chennai, along with neighboring Bengaluru and Hyderabad, is poised for significant growth, with a projected 65 percent increase in data center capacity over the next decade.
